Research & Strategy
Data gathering steps, user mapping, and structural decisions.
We performed a complete audit of existing email history logs and documentation to map connection points and establish the base prompt structure. We designed a structure centered on clean performance thresholds and data boundary policies.
- • 65% of customer queries centered on repetitive configuration questions.
- • Traditional keyword matching was ineffective due to varying language styles.
- • Adopt OpenAI GPT-4 as the primary processing LLM for high reasoning capabilities.
- • Isolate client databases using Supabase Row Level Security (RLS).
Solution Overview
Modular layout systems, automations, and frontend iterations.
A complete autonomous support hub that acts as an edge parser. It intercepts client emails, queries vector stores, evaluates reply validation, and delivers natural responses.
Performs RAG indexing on custom documentation vectors.
Filters generated text against security rules and brand guidelines.

Before vs After
Process improvements and operational workflow comparative matrices.
Emails received -> Staff manually reads and categorizes -> Manual database checks -> Reply drafted and sent in 48-72 hours.
Email received -> Automated webhook processes text -> Vector lookup -> Prompt validation -> Direct response delivered in <2 mins.
- • Reduced administrative time required to resolve basic setup questions.
- • Centralized logs tracking query classifications automatically.
- • Average support staff requirements for queue cleaning decreased.
- • Increased volume of resolved inquiries per hour.
